To: Erik Latranyi
The host is responsible for security outside the embassy compound. A horde of mutants storming the walls of a diplomatic compound is absolutely a violation of the host country's responsibilities under international law.

That's why you don't see this sort of sh!t in civilized countries.

The vote poses a pivotal test to an American troop presence that has been instrumental in the defeat of Islamic State, even as powerful Iranian-backed factions have come to dominate the Iraqi government. One of those militias, Kataib Hezbollah, threatened lawmakers who failed to show up at the session or vote in favor of a law to evict U.S. forces, branding them “traitors.”
